The Ingredient Breakdown

When determining if a cheese is Halal, the primary concern is the source of the enzymes and the presence of any alcohol or animal by-products. Let's look at the specific components of LIGHT STRING.

The base ingredient is Pasteurized Part Skim Milk. This is a standard dairy product and is inherently Halal. The Cheese Cultures are bacteria used to ferment the milk; these are microbial and pose no Halal issues. Salt is a mineral and is safe.

The most critical ingredient to analyze is the Enzymes. In cheese making, enzymes (specifically rennet) are used to curdle the milk. Rennet can be derived from animals (calf or lamb stomach lining) or from microbial/bio-engineered sources. While animal-derived rennet is technically from a Halal animal, the Hanafi school of thought generally advises against consuming it unless certified. However, in the case of mass-market cheeses like LIGHT STRING, manufacturers almost exclusively use Microbial Enzymes (derived from fungi, yeast, or bacteria) or Fermentation-Produced Chymosin (FPC) to keep the product accessible to a wide market. Without a specific flag indicating animal rennet, we can safely assume the enzymes are microbial and Halal.


Nutritional Value

As the name suggests, LIGHT STRING is formulated to be a lower-calorie alternative to standard cheese. By using part-skim milk, the fat content is reduced, which lowers the overall calorie count. This makes it a suitable option for those monitoring their fat intake while still wanting the protein benefits of dairy.

Because it is a 'light' version, it fits well into diet plans that restrict high-fat foods. However, it is important to remember that cheese still contains sodium. If you are on a strict low-sodium diet, you should consume it in moderation, but for general health and weight management, it is a solid choice.
